NCT ID: NCT04142177 Recruiting - Clinical trials for Chronic Low Back Pain

Sequential and Comparative Evaluation of Pain Treatment Effectiveness Response

SCEPTER
Start date: June 13, 2022
Phase: N/A
Study type: Interventional

VETERANS ONLY. Chronic low back pain (cLBP) is common. Most Americans will have at least one episode of low back pain in their lifetimes. Approximately 50% of all US Veterans have chronic pain, and CLBP is the most common type of pain in this population. This study will use a sequential randomized, pragmatic, 2-step comparative effectiveness study design. The main goal is to identify the best approach for treating cLBP using commonly recommended non-surgical and non-pharmacological options. The first step compares continued care and active monitoring (CCAM) to internet-based pain self-management (Pain EASE) and an enhanced physical therapy intervention that combines Pain EASE with tailored exercise and physical activity. Patients who do not have a significant decrease in pain interference (a functional outcome) in Step 1 and those desiring additional treatment will be randomized in Step 2 to yoga, spinal manipulation therapy (SMT), or therapist-delivered cognitive behavioral therapy (CBT). Participants proceeding to randomization in Step 2 will be allowed to exclude up to one of the three Step 2 treatments based on their preferences. The investigators' primary hypothesis for the first treatment step is that an enhanced physical therapy intervention that combines pain self-management education with a tailored exercise program will reduce pain interference greater than internet-based pain self-management alone or CCAM in Veterans with cLBP. The primary outcome is change in pain interference at 3 months, measured using the Brief Pain Inventory (BPI) pain interference subscale. Study participants will be followed for one year after initiation of their final study treatments to assess the durability of treatment effects. The study plans to randomize 2529 patients across 20 centers.

NCT ID: NCT04129437 Recruiting - Low Back Pain Clinical Trials

Acute Low Back Pain in the Emergency Department Treated With Osteopathic Manipulative Treatment Versus NSAIDs

Start date: February 19, 2020
Phase: Phase 4
Study type: Interventional

Acute low back pain is the fifth most common presenting complaint to the emergency department, accounting for approximately 4.4% of annual visits. The treatment for acute low back pain is often NSAIDs or other analgesic medications. Osteopathic Manipulative Treatment (OMT) has been shown to be an effective treatment modality for acute low back pain, however, it's use in the emergency department setting is not well described. The adjunct of OMT has the potential to increase patient satisfaction, decrease length of stay and decrease the number of unnecessary prescription medications. We plan to investigate the use of OMT in the setting of acute complaints of low back pain in comparison to the use of nonsteroidal anti-inflammatory drugs (NSAIDs) as primary treatment modality. The study will be a non-blinded randomized-control trial and will take place in an academic tertiary care center in urban Philadelphia, PA over an approximate one-year timespan. We will utilize osteopathic-trained attending and resident physicians to perform the manipulation. Patients will be randomized into one of three treatment groups: appropriately dosed NSAID therapy alone, OMT in addition to NSAID therapy, or OMT alone. The primary outcome will be the difference in pain score before and after treatment using a VAS scale. Secondary outcomes will include patient and physician satisfaction immediately following treatment. Results will be shared by means of publication to the osteopathic and allopathic communities.

NCT ID: NCT04120532 Recruiting - Low Back Pain Clinical Trials

Effects of Health Education for Patients Received Minimally Invasive Lumbar Spinal Surgery

Start date: April 25, 2019
Phase: N/A
Study type: Interventional

Lumbar degenerative disease surgery has been a routine clinical operation, and has good treatment effects. Although the patient's neurological symptoms improve after surgery, many patients still have postoperative muscle soreness. The postoperative rehabilitation intervention for the patients receiving traditional lumbar surgery has been confirmed to effectively improve pain and disability. However, in recent years, minimally invasive lumbar spinal surgery has gradually replaced traditional surgery, postoperative pain has been greatly reduced. Therefore, patients have the opportunity to receive early intervention in rehabilitation, but there is no standardization process for rehabilitation of minimally invasive lumbar spine surgery. Therefore, this study aims to establish a health education program for patients receiving minimally invasive lumbar spinal surgery, and conduct clinical trials to test its effectiveness.

NCT ID: NCT04111315 Recruiting - Low Back Pain Clinical Trials

Efficacy of Metamizole Versus Ibuprofen and a Short Educational Intervention Versus Standard Care in Acute Low Back Pain

EMISI
Start date: December 15, 2019
Phase: Phase 4
Study type: Interventional

The EMISI trial is a randomized, double blind, controlled trial (RCT) using a factorial design in patients with a new low back pain episode. The study aims to assess (A) whether metamizole, a non-opioid drug approved in Switzerland for pain treatment, is non-inferior to ibuprofen in a new episode of acute or subacute LBP and (B) whether a short educational intervention including evidence-based patient information is superior to usual care alone. Despite its increased use, the role of metamizole for the treatment of LBP is unclear and has so far not been systematically studied.

NCT ID: NCT04086199 Recruiting - Clinical trials for Back Pain Lower Back Chronic

Spinal Approach for Lumbar Active Discopathy

Start date: January 1, 2020
Phase:
Study type: Observational

The study aims to study the impact on different surgical approaches for lumbar active discopathy. This inflammatory disease of the disc and adjacent vertebral endplates can induce low back pain with inflammatory-like features. Lumbar fusion is proposed to the patient when conservative management is not enough. This fusion can be obtained by an anterior muscle sparring approach or by a posterior muscle decaying approach. The goal with this single center retrospective study is to identify the surgical approach that offers to the patient the better long term functional outcome. A phone call would allow us to ask patients a few questions: - Mcnab's criteria - Roland Morris Disability Questionnaire The patients medical file review would also allow us to identify: - the length of hospital stay for the discectomy (in days) - incidence of Failed Back Surgery Syndrome - incidence of redo surgeries - incidence of adjacent level diseases - incidence of dural tears and eventual complications (meningitis, orthostatic headaches,...) - incidence of iliac vessels injuries and eventual complications (thrombosis, need for revascularisation,...)
